Fog Pharmaceuticals, Inc.
![]() Fog Pharmaceuticals, Inc. BiotechnologyHealth Technology Fog Pharmaceuticals, Inc. develops pharmaceutical products. It discovers and develops cell-penetrating miniproteins (CPMPs), which are specifically designed to target cancer-causing proteins inside cancer cells and neutralize them. The company was founded by Gregory L. Verdine, WeiQing Zhou and David Philip Lane and is headquartered in Cambridge, MA.

American Society of Clinical Oncology, Inc.
![]() American Society of Clinical Oncology, Inc. Medical/Nursing ServicesHealth Services The American Society of Clinical Oncology is a non-profit organization founded in 1964 with the overarching goals of improving cancer care and prevention. More than 27,000 oncology practitioners belong to ASCO, representing all oncology disciplines and subspecialties. Members include physicians and health-care professionals in all levels of the practice of oncology. American Society of Clinical Oncology is the world’s leading professional organization representing physicians who treat people with cancer. ASCO’s members set the standard for patient care worldwide and lead the way in carrying out clinical research aimed at improving the prevention, diagnosis, and treatment of cancer.
